The Mint, an unabridged collection, presents a compelling exploration of military life through the prismatic lens of T.E. Lawrence, known as Lawrence of Arabia. This anthology captures the broader narratives of discipline, camaraderie, and the relentless grind of daily routines in a military setting, using a variety of literary styles that range from gritty realism to reflective introspection. The significance of this collection lies in its raw portrayal of the human spirit under the pressures of service, offering readers standout pieces that delve into the psychological and physical experiences of soldiers. The Mint stands as a testament to the diversity and depth of military life, challenging readers to consider the complexities behind the uniform. T.E. Lawrence's background as a British archaeologist, army officer, diplomat, and writer, most famously known for his liaison role during the Great Arab Revolt against the Ottoman Empire during World War I, provides a unique perspective that enriches this collection. His experiences, immortalized through his written works, place The Mint within a historical and cultural context that spans various literary movements. Lawrence's ability to capture the essence of his experiences brings together a rich tapestry of tales that reflect both the mundane and the profound aspects of military service. His singular voice infuses the anthology with authenticity and insight, contributing to the broader understanding of the human condition within the confines of discipline and duty.
